Here is the synopsis for “The Hurt Locker”:
“The Hurt Locker,” which is the winner of the 2008 Venice Film Festival SIGNIS Grand Prize, is a riveting and suspenseful portrait of the courage under fire of the military’s unrecognized heroes: the technicians of a bomb squad who volunteer to challenge the odds and save lives in one of the world’s most dangerous places.
Three members of the U.S. Army’s elite Explosive Ordnance Disposal (EOD) squad battle insurgents and each other as they search for and disarm a wave of roadside bombs on the streets of Baghdad to make the city a safer place for Iraqis and Americans alike.
Their mission is clear – protect and save – but it’s anything but easy as the margin of error when defusing a war-zone bomb is zero. This thrilling and heart-pounding look at the effects of combat and danger on the human psyche is based on the firsthand observations of journalist and screenwriter Mark Boal who was embedded in a special bomb unit in Iraq. These men spoke of explosions as putting you in “the hurt locker”.
Acclaimed director Kathryn Bigelow brings together groundbreaking realistic action and intimate human drama in a landmark film starring Jeremy Renner (“Dahmer,” “The Assassination of Jesse James”), Anthony Mackie (“Half Nelson,” “We Are Marshall”) and Brian Geraghty (“We Are Marshall,” “Jarhead”) with cameo appearances by Ralph Fiennes (“The Reader”), David Morse (“John Adams”), Evangeline Lilly (“Lost”) and Guy Pearce (“Memento”).
“The Hurt Locker” is produced by Kathryn Bigelow, Mark Boal, Greg Shapiro and Nicolas Chartier. The screenplay is written by Mark Boal (the story of “In the Valley of Elah”). Barry Ackroyd (“United 93,” “The Wind That Shakes the Barley”) is the director of photography. The production designer is Karl Juliusson (“K19: The Widowmaker,” “Breaking the Waves”).
Editors are Bob Murawski (“Spider-Man 2,” “Spider-Man 3”) and Chris Innis. The costume designer is George Little (“Jarhead,” “Crimson Tide”). Music is by Academy Award nominee Marco Beltrami (“Knowing”) and Buck Sanders (“3:10 to Yuma”). Sound design is by Academy Award nominee Paul N.J. Ottosson (“Spider-Man 2,” “Spider-Man 3”).
